Axon Enterprise Inc (NASDAQ: AXON) reported second-quarter revenue of $904.39 million on Wednesday, exceeding analyst estimates of $876.46 million and marking a 35% year-over-year increase. Despite the strong financial performance and an upward revision to full-year guidance, shares fell 6.32% in after-hours trading to $570.95, reflecting investor caution or profit-taking following the earnings release.

The company’s growth was broad-based across its core segments. Software and Services revenue rose 36% year-over-year to $398 million, while Connected Devices revenue grew 35% to $507 million. Management attributed the surge to sustained demand from both new and existing customers.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) also expanded significantly, increasing 39% year-over-year to $1.6 billion, primarily fueled by adoption of premium software offerings.

Financial Performance and Guidance

Axon delivered adjusted earnings per share of $1.88 for the quarter, beating consensus estimates of $1.85 per share. The company ended the period with a solid liquidity position, holding $685 million in cash, cash equivalents, and short-term investments as of June 30.

Looking ahead, Axon raised its full-year 2026 revenue guidance from a previous range of $3.61 billion to $3.67 billion to a new range of $3.67 billion to $3.73 billion. This update surpassed analyst expectations of $3.66 billion, signaling management’s confidence in continued momentum through the remainder of the fiscal year.

What the Numbers Show

The divergence between the stock’s negative price action and the positive earnings surprise warrants attention. While the top-line growth of 35% and the beat on both revenue and EPS metrics are objectively strong, the market’s reaction suggests that investors may have priced in higher expectations or are concerned about valuation levels relative to future growth rates. The significant rise in ARR to $1.6 billion indicates a healthy recurring revenue base, which typically supports higher valuation multiples, yet the immediate sell-off implies a potential reassessment of risk or near-term outlook by institutional holders.

The strength in the Software and Services segment, growing faster than hardware, underscores Axon’s successful transition toward a recurring-revenue model. This structural shift reduces dependency on one-off device sales and provides greater visibility into future cash flows, a key factor likely supporting the raised full-year guidance.

Axon will release its second quarter 2026 financial results after the market closes on August 5, 2026. The global public safety technology leader will host a live Zoom video webinar to discuss the financial performance at 5:00 p.m. ET on the same day. Access to the webinar and subsequent replay will be available through Axon's investor relations website at https://investor.axon.com .

About Axon

Axon (NASDAQ: AXON) operates as a global leader in public safety technology. The company's product ecosystem includes TASER energy devices, cameras, sensors, drones, robotics, and digital evidence management systems. These solutions are designed to serve law enforcement, enterprise security, and national security sectors. Founded in 1993, Axon emphasizes responsible innovation supported by an independent Ethics & Equity Advisory Council.
